Description

A detached house situated in a favoured location within a short distance of beautiful riverside walks. The accommodation provides on the ground floor hall, dual aspect sitting room with feature log burner, cloakroom, dual aspect kitchen/diner, and utility room. Upstairs, the principal bedroom has fitted wardrobe and en-suite shower room, three further bedrooms and bathroom. The property is warmed by gas fired central heating. Outside, to the front of the property the garden has lawn, various mature shrubs, flower border and path to the front door. The driveway offers parking that in turn leads to the double garage. The generous size rear garden is enclosed with patio area, lawn, various mature shrubs and side gated pedestrian access. An internal viewing is essential to appreciate this lovely home, the location and the rear garden. Durrington has a good range of amenities to include a swimming pool and gym, and is ideally placed for the A303 road network.
